What does it mean when someone says "he is tooting his own horn."
Example: "Wow! I played awesome in that game today, I think I'm the best one on the team"
It means you brag about yourself.

What does this mean: "Oh my boss...she's the big cheese."
Being the big cheese means someone is very important!
You might call a boss, the president, or any other important person the big cheese.
